Q:

The perimeter of a rectangle is 42 inches. If the width of the rectangle is 6 inches, what is the length? A. 12 inches B. 15 inches C. 21 inches D. 40 inches

Accepted Solution

A:
Answer: 15 InchesStep-by-step explanation:Remember that the Perimeter of a rectangle is the distance around it.So,     Perimeter = Length + Width + Length + Width or      P = 2L + 2W If P=42 inches and W = 6 inches,     42 = 2L + 2(6)     42 = 2L + 12     30 = 2L              [subtract 12 from both sides]     15 = L               [divide both sides by 2] The length (L) is 15 inches.
